[pgsql-ayuda] agregates con mod_perl
Jesus Aneiros
aneiros@jagua.cfg.sld.cu
Sun, 23 Jul 2000 19:10:32 -0400 (EDT)
Bueno espero que el select doble sea cuestion de error al pasar el mensaje
no? Lo otro es el print sin argumento?!
A mi me funciona perfecto este programa:
#!/usr/bin/perl
use strict;
use DBI;
my $dbh = DBI->connect("dbi:Pg:dbname=ships", "", "");
my $query = "SELECT max(launched) FROM ships";
my $sth = $dbh->prepare($query);
$sth->execute;
while ( my @rows = $sth->fetchrow_array ) {
# statements.....
print "@rows\n";
}
$sth->finish;
$dbh->disconnect;
On Sun, 23 Jul 2000, Ra?l Arg?ez wrote:
> Tengo el siguiente problema (que creo es de conocimientos elementales), al usar
> psql y tratar de saber el maximo valor de una columana uso:
>
> select max (numreg) from clientes;
>
> el resultado me es devuelto sin ningun problema, pero cuando lo trato de hacer
> desde un script con mod_perl no encuentro la manera de extraer el resultado del
> query:
>
> $result=$conn->exec ("select select max (numreg) from clientes");
>
> es mas la sentecia:
>
> die $conn->errorMessage unless $PGRES_TUPLES_OK eq $result->$resultStatus;
>
> me regresa un error al intentar ejecutar el scrit.
>
> el resultado lo trato de extraer de la manera clasica:
>
> while (@row=$rsult->fetchrow){
> print ;
> }
>
> ¿Alguien me pudiera indicar que estoy haciendo mal?
>
> De antemano gracias.
>
>
> Raúl Argáez
> --------- Pie de mensaje -------------------------------------------
> Archivo historico: http://tlali.iztacala.unam.mx/maillist/pgsql-ayuda
> Cancelar inscripcion:
> mail to: majordomo@tlali.iztacala.unam.mx
> text : unsubscribe pgsql-ayuda
>
--------- Pie de mensaje -------------------------------------------
Archivo historico: http://tlali.iztacala.unam.mx/maillist/pgsql-ayuda
Cancelar inscripcion:
mail to: majordomo@tlali.iztacala.unam.mx
text : unsubscribe pgsql-ayuda